WebCSAT: Certified Systemic Art Therapist (counseling) CSAT: Charter School for Applied Technologies (Buffalo, NY) CSAT: Crew System Associate Technology: CSAT: Combat … WebDec 22, 2024 · The goal of the CSAT is to determine how satisfied customers are with the services, goods, business, or customer service team. Customers are asked about their level of happiness regarding one or more aspects of the business. The answers taken from a CSAT are expressed as a percentage, ranging from 0 to 100%. Customer Effort Score (CES) The customer effort score (CES) is a metric that measures how easy it is for customers to interact and engage with your products or services.. To calculate customer effort scores, divide the number of ratings of 5, 6, and 7 on a scale of 1 to 7 by the number of responses, and multiply by 100.
